Problems solved by technology

However, due to the rapid hydrolysis of urea in the rumen, and the rate of ammonia utilization by microorganisms in the rumen is only 1 / 4 of its decomposition rate, microorganisms can only use a small part of ammonia to synthesize bacterial protein, and the rest of the microorganisms have no time to use. It is absorbed into the blood by the rumen wall, so that a large amount of ammonia enters the body through the urea cycle of the body, resulting in an increase in blood ammonia concentration. When it reaches a certain level, poisoning symptoms will occur, and in severe cases, it will cause animal death.

Embodiment 1

[0024] First remove the moldy and degenerated raw materials, impurities, soil blocks, etc. in the air-dried grains and beans, and then mix the crushed grains, beans, cakes, non-protein nitrogen and bentonite according to the following weight percentages: 77 %, 7%, 3%, 10%, 3%; and puffed in an extruder; the puffed raw materials are put into a pulverizer for pulverization; After the components are mixed, they are stirred in a mixer to prepare compound biochemical protein feed for cattle and sheep.

Embodiment 2

[0026] First remove the moldy and degenerated raw materials, impurities, soil lumps, etc. in the air-dried grains and beans, and then mix the crushed grains, beans, cakes, non-protein nitrogen and bentonite according to the following weight percentages: 71 %, 8%, 2%, 15%, 4%; and puffed in an extruder; the puffed raw materials are put into a pulverizer for pulverization; After the components are mixed, they are stirred in a mixer to prepare compound biochemical protein feed for cattle and sheep.

Embodiment 3

[0028] First remove the moldy and degenerated raw materials, impurities, soil lumps, etc. in the air-dried grains and beans, and then mix the crushed grains, beans, cakes, non-protein nitrogen and bentonite according to the following weight percentage: 65 %, 9%, 1%, 20%, 5%; and expand in an extruder; the expanded raw materials are put into a pulverizer for crushing; the crushed above-mentioned raw materials and 0% biological protein feed are mixed by weight After the components are mixed, they are stirred in a mixer to prepare compound biochemical protein feed for cattle and sheep.

Abstract

The invention relates to high-efficiency compound biopeptide forage for ruminants and a production method thereof. The production method includes the following steps: raw material is primarily selected, crashed, swelled and formulated; the swelled raw material is filled in a grinder for crashing; after being mixed by weight percentage, the crashed and swelled raw material and the biopeptide forage are stirred in a forage mixer. The production method breaks through the formulation and the production technology of the concentrated feed of the protein of cows and sheep; the swelling technique, the urea slow release technique, the biotechnique and the nutrition regulation technique of the ruminants are adopted for the scientific and reasonable collocation of nonprotein nitrogen, cereal seeds,soybeans, seed cakes and agricultural products, then cows and sheep protein forage with high efficiency, high energy and high protein is produced by utilizing the swelling technique, the urea slow release technique and the nutrition balance technique. The production technology can increase the utilization rate of nonprotein nitrogen substance such as the urea, and the like, for the ruminants, prevent the ruminants from urea poisoning, reduce feeding cost and have overall nutrition.

Description

technical field [0001] The invention relates to the technical field of animal feed, in particular to a high-efficiency compound biochemical protein feed for ruminants and a production method thereof. Background technique [0002] Supplementing protein nutrition for animals by adding protein feed is a good way to obtain meat products with high protein content. However, due to the lack of protein feed resources in our country, it is impossible to meet the growing demand. Therefore, new protein feed resources must be developed and utilized to reduce feed costs. [0003] Ruminants such as cattle and sheep can convert non-protein nitrogen such as urea into animal protein. The mechanism of action is as follows: cattle are ruminants, and the whole stomach is composed of rumen, reticulum, omasum and abomasum.
